Subject: [GIT-PULL] cpuidle fixes for 3.12
Date: Mon, 12 Aug 2013 11:41:29 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<5208ADC9.2050309@linaro.org> (raw)

The following changes since commit d4e4ab86bcba5a72779c43dc1459f71fea3d89c8:

Linux 3.11-rc5 (2013-08-11 18:04:20 -0700)

are available in the git repository at:

git://git.linaro.org/people/dlezcano/linux.git cpuidle/arm-next

for you to fetch changes up to 75d6137da195a1e059e1c814cb95635e168f85c0:

cpuidle: kirkwood: Make kirkwood_cpuidle_remove function static
(2013-08-12 11:28:50 +0200)

This series fixes some compilation issues:

* for SH, a parameter is missing for the cpuidle_register function
* for Calxeda, an _iomem annotation is missing for scu_base_addr variable
* for kirkwood, a static declaration is missing for the
kirkwood_cpuidle_remove function
